On August 14 the first 200.000kms complete with this f800gs
In summary:
Reviews 10,000 kms. according to the maintenance manual.
consumables:
- 8638 liters of petrol
- 17 sets of tires.
- 7 sets of rear pads.
- 2 sets of front pads, (near the third game).
- 5 sets of transmission.
- 1 set of front discs
- 1 rear disc.
Maintenance / repair most significant:
- 2 sets of steering head bearings
- 2 sets of rear bearings
- Several checkpoints
- battery
- alternator
- Fuel pump
- Water pump
- Loop antenna
PS 5 sets of transmission = 5 Sets of chains and sprockets.
